Hi I have a simple question: Is TechNet really worth the cash? I know someone that just had $500 shelled out for the service. But seems as I remember someone saying that exact information that TechNet provides is availalbe on MS's knowldegebase on the Microsoft web site. Waste of money or what?
 
The knowledge base is available online. Regular TechNet also includes service packs (available online, but it's nice to have the CD - like when you need the 200MB Exchange 2000 Service Pack 2), and resource kits (not available online - very much worth it). The $450 TechNet Plus that the person you know appears to have purchased also includes Beta and Evaluation versions of many MS products. For me, it's worth it. Yes absolutely!
Even if you only use the resource kits. If you get these separately it will cost 3-4 times the subscription cost. As Marc says the Single User TechNet+ (£240 UK) includes Evaluations & Betas and gives me the capabilities for software testing without paying for a product I may only need for a few days.
